The Impacts of Global Warming

The Concequences of Global Warming Are Far-Reaching and Impact Various Aspects of Our Planet:

1. Rising Temperatures

The Earth’s average temperature you have increased by about 1 Degree Celsius (1.8 Degrees Fahrenheit) since the late 19th Century. This Rise in Temperature Leads to Heatwaves, Drooughts, and Extreme Weather Events Becoming More Frequent and Intense.

2. Melting Ice and Rising Sea Levels

The Warming Planet is causing Ice Caps, Glaciers, and Polar Ice Sheets to Melt at an Alarming Rate. This Results in the Rise of Sea Levels, Threatening Coastal Communities and Low-Lying Areas. It also disruptions marine ecosystems and increases The Risk of Flooding During Storms.

3. Ocean Acidification

Excess Carbon Dioxide Absorbed by The Ocean Leads to Increase Acidity. This Acidification Harms Marine Life, particularly Coral Reefs, Shellfish, and other organisms that relay on Calcium Carbonate for Growth and Survival. It disruptions the balance of ecosystems and threatens food security for communities that relay on the ocean for support.

4. CHANGES IN PRECITATION PATTERNS

Climate Change AFFFECTS PATTERNS, Leading to More Frequent and Intense Rainfall, as well as Extended periods of drugs in Certain Regions. These changes can have devastating effects on Agriculture, Water Availability, and Ecosystem Stability.

5. Biodiversity loss

Global Warming Exacerbates The Loss of Biodiversity by Disrupting habitats and altering ecosystems. Rising Temperatures, Changing Precision Patterns, and Ocean Acidification Endanger A Wide Range of Plant and Animal Species, Leading to Imbalances and Potential Extinctions.

Solutions to Global Warming

mitigating and adapting to Global Warming Requirements Collective Action on a Global Scale. Here are potential solutions:

1. Renewable Energy Sources

Transitioning to renewable energy sources such solar, Wind, and Geothermal Power is crucial in Reducting Greenhouse gas emissions. Investing in Clean Energy Technologies and Promoting ES adoption is essential for substantial future.

2. Energy efficiency

Improving Energy Efficient in Buildings, Transportation, and Industries Can Signantly Reduces Carbon Emissions. This includes using Energy-Efficient Appliances, Implementing Green Building Practices, and Promoting Public Transportation and Carpooling.

3. Reforestation and afforestation

Planting Trees and Restoring Forest Helps Absorb Carbon Dioxide From The Atmosphere, Mitigating The Impacts of Global Warming. ADDITIONALLY, PROTECTING EXISTING Forets is crucial as they serve as Important Carbon Sinks and Biodiversity Hotspots.

4. Sustainable Agriculture

AGRICULTURAL SUBSTAINABLE IMPLEMING Practices Precision Farming, Organic Farming, and Efficient Irrigation Can Reduces Methane Emissions and Promote Carbon Sequestration in Soil. Shifting Towards Plant-Based Diets Also Minimizes The Environmento Footprint of the Food System.

5. Climate Adaptation

adapting to the changing climate is equally important to reduce the impacts of global warmg. This Investing in Resilient Infrastructure, Developing Early Warning Systems, and Implementing Strategies to Protect Vulnerable Communities and Ecosystems.
